Gilded Age
denotes a period in late 19th-century America, characterized by rapid economic growth, industrialization, and ostentatious displays of wealth, alongside widespread social and political corruption.
Political Parties
Political parties are organized groups of people with similar political ideologies and objectives that compete in elections to hold power in government.
Sectional Divisions
Regional disagreements and conflicts within a country, often based on economic, social, or political differences.
Munn v. Illinois
An 1877 U.S. Supreme Court case that upheld the power of state governments to regulate private industries in the public interest.
